Between May 14 and 22, 2025, the China National Tourist Office (London) hosted a major familiarisation tour across Guizhou Province and the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, bringing together 33 tourism experts from across Europe. Among the invited guests was Pat McCarthy, an Irish philanthropist and the founder of the Ireland Sino Institute.
Although officially a delegate, McCarthy approached the experience with a deep sense of purpose, viewing it as a personal mission to raise global awareness of southwest China’s natural beauty, cultural richness, and social potential.
“St. Patrick walked Ireland not just as a figure of history, but as a builder of unity and understanding,” McCarthy reflected.
“In the same spirit, I want to walk new lands, connect cultures, and help share the stories and wisdom of places like Guizhou and Guangxi with the world.”
Building Bridges Through Tourism
The delegation, which included participants from Ireland, the UK, Finland, and Norway, was part of a larger initiative to foster deeper tourism and cultural ties between Europe and China. During the tour, McCarthy also signed a Memorandum of Understanding with Guizhou officials, laying the groundwork for ongoing collaboration in cultural exchange and tourism development.
Exploring Guizhou
The journey through Guizhou included iconic sites such as Huangguoshu Waterfall, the Baling River Bridge, and ancient Dong and Miao ethnic villages. Visitors were treated to vibrant folk performances and traditional hospitality, offering an authentic glimpse into local heritage.
The delegation also explored the UNESCO-listed karst landscapes of Libo, including Xiaoqikong, Daqikong, and Cuigu Waterfall—known for their lush biodiversity and surreal natural beauty.
Discovering Guangxi
In Guangxi, the group visited the secluded Baiku Yao Village, the massive Dongtian Shengjing cave network, and the renowned Bama County, a region celebrated for its high concentration of centenarians and emphasis on health and wellness.
The tour underscored Guangxi’s growing appeal as a destination for eco-tourism, cultural heritage, and longevity-based travel.
A Lasting Mission
Since returning to Europe, McCarthy has been actively promoting both provinces through media, events, and institutional networks. His efforts have helped spark increased interest in Guizhou and Guangxi as meaningful, culturally rich destinations.
According to Zhang Li, head of CNTO London, the tour represented the largest European familiarisation delegation to visit these regions to date—marking a milestone in Europe-China tourism collaboration.
Tourism with Purpose
Drawing inspiration from St. Patrick’s legacy of service and outreach, McCarthy believes that travel and cultural understanding can play a key role in uplifting communities. His hope is that increased tourism will not only bring visitors, but also help drive poverty reduction, economic opportunity, and shared prosperity in underdeveloped areas of Guizhou and Guangxi.
“When cultures meet with mutual respect and purpose,” McCarthy said, “everyone rises together.”
